Assessing your consumption patterns is crucial for choosing the best energy solutions for both your home and business. Start by collecting data on your current energy usage over the past year. Analyzing monthly bills can give you insights into peak consumption times and seasonal fluctuations. Are there specific months where usage spikes? Understanding these patterns helps identify which energy solutions will cater effectively to your requirements, whether it be through renewable sources, energy-efficient appliances, or optimized heating and cooling systems.
Furthermore, consider the unique characteristics of your space. Factors such as the size of your home or business, the number of occupants, and the types of activities conducted within your premises all influence energy consumption. For instance, businesses operating heavy machinery may require a different energy solution compared to a small office space. By evaluating these specifics, you can determine whether a centralized energy system or decentralized options suit your needs better. Ultimately, a thorough understanding of your consumption patterns will empower you to make informed decisions on energy solutions that align with your goals and reduce potential waste.
When choosing energy solutions for homes and businesses, it's essential to evaluate both renewable and non-renewable energy sources. Renewable energy, which includes solar, wind, hydroelectric, and geothermal power, has gained significant traction due to its sustainability and minimal environmental impact. According to the International Energy Agency (IEA), renewable energy accounted for nearly 30% of global electricity generation in 2020, a figure that is expected to rise as investments increase and technology advances. By adopting renewable energy sources, consumers can reduce their carbon footprint and contribute to a more sustainable future while often benefiting from lower energy costs in the long term.
On the other hand, non-renewable energy sources, such as coal, natural gas, and oil, continue to dominate the energy market due to their established infrastructure and immediate availability. However, the environmental consequences of fossil fuel usage are significant, contributing to air pollution and climate change. A report from the U.S. Energy Information Administration (EIA) indicates that approximately 60% of electricity in the United States was generated from non-renewable sources in 2020. While these options may provide reliability and consistency, the urge for cleaner alternatives is prompting many to seek out greener solutions that align with evolving regulatory frameworks and public sentiments regarding climate change. The choice between renewable and non-renewable energy sources ultimately depends on individual needs, local regulations, and long-term sustainability goals.

When evaluating energy efficiency for your home and business, understanding the key technologies and practices is essential. One of the primary technologies to consider is smart home systems, which allow for automated control of lighting, heating, and appliances. These systems enable significant reductions in energy consumption by optimizing usage based on your habits and preferences. For businesses, incorporating energy management systems can provide real-time monitoring of energy usage, helping identify areas for improvement and fostering a culture of sustainability.
In addition to technological solutions, employing effective practices is crucial for enhancing energy efficiency. Conducting regular energy audits can help identify inefficiencies and opportunities for improvement, such as upgrading insulation or sealing leaks. Implementing energy-efficient practices, like utilizing programmable thermostats and energy-saving lighting, can lead to substantial energy savings over time. Furthermore, considering renewable energy options, such as solar panels, can not only reduce dependence on conventional energy sources but also lower overall energy costs in the long run. By combining technology with proactive energy practices, both homes and businesses can develop effective strategies for sustainable energy use.
When considering energy solutions for both homes and businesses, a thorough cost analysis is essential for effective budgeting. Start by estimating your current energy expenses and determine the proportion of your budget that can be allocated toward new energy solutions. This requires an understanding of your energy consumption patterns, peak usage times, and the potential savings that alternative energy sources can provide. Implementing energy-efficient appliances and technologies might involve an upfront investment but can lead to substantial long-term savings.
In parallel, explore various financing options available for renewable energy installations, such as solar panels or energy-efficient systems. Incentives may be offered by local governments or other organizations, which can significantly reduce initial costs. Calculating ROI (Return on Investment) on these solutions will help in understanding the payback period and overall benefit to your financial health. Additionally, consider maintenance and operational costs when evaluating your options to ensure that you can sustain any energy solution in the long run. This comprehensive approach will assist in making informed decisions that align with your budgetary constraints while achieving energy efficiency goals.
When selecting energy solutions for homes and businesses, understanding regulatory considerations is crucial. Permits and incentives often dictate the feasibility and cost-effectiveness of adopting renewable energy systems. For instance, a 2021 report by the Renewable Energy Industry Association stated that 70% of new solar projects were facilitated by government incentives, showcasing how these financial mechanisms can significantly lower initial costs. Homeowners and business owners should investigate local and federal policies that can provide tax credits or rebates for renewable energy installations, such as solar panels or energy-efficient upgrades.
Navigating the permitting process is another important aspect. Many states have streamlined their permitting processes for renewable energy solutions, but this varies widely by location. According to a 2022 study from the National Renewable Energy Laboratory, regions with simplified permitting processes saw a 30% increase in solar installations compared to those with more cumbersome requirements. Understanding these regulatory frameworks can not only expedite project timelines but also enhance the overall return on investment. Therefore, it's imperative for consumers to stay informed about the evolving landscape of energy regulations and incentives in their respective areas, ensuring they make the best choices for sustainable energy adoption.
